Describe the functions of the spleen? Why is the total splenectomy (that is, surgical elimination of the spleen) compatible with life?
Expert
The spleen has numerous functions: it participates in the demolition of old red blood cells; in it specialized leukocytes are matured; it aids the renewal of hematopoietic tissue of the bone marrow whenever essential; it can act as a sponge like organ to retain or release blood from or for the circulation. Total splenectomy is not unsuited with life as none of the functions of spleen are crucial and at similar time exclusive of this organ.
